How to Overcome Irregular Digestion Naturally

Irregular digestion can be an uncomfortable and frustrating experience. It often manifests as bloating, gas, constipation, or diarrhea. Fortunately, there are many natural approaches you can adopt to improve your digestive health. Here’s how to overcome irregular digestion naturally.

Firstly, one of the most effective strategies is to adjust your dietary choices. Increasing your intake of fiber-rich foods can promote better digestion. Foods such as whole grains, fruits, vegetables, legumes, and nuts are excellent sources of dietary fiber. Fiber helps to bulk up stool and promotes regular bowel movements. On the other hand, it’s essential to drink plenty of water, as fiber works best when it absorbs water. Aim for at least 8-10 glasses a day to aid digestion and prevent constipation.

Probiotics also play a crucial role in maintaining a healthy gut microbiome. These beneficial bacteria help balance your digestive system, supporting both digestion and absorption of nutrients. Incorporating fermented foods into your diet, such as yogurt, kefir, sauerkraut, kimchi, and miso, can provide a significant boost in the probiotic department. If you find it challenging to consume enough fermented foods, consider taking a high-quality probiotic supplement after consulting with a healthcare professional.

Another natural remedy for irregular digestion is herbal teas. Ginger and peppermint teas are particularly known for their soothing properties. Ginger helps to stimulate digestion and reduce nausea, while peppermint can relax your digestive system and alleviate gas and bloating. Drinking a cup of herbal tea after meals can promote digestive comfort and support a regular digestive rhythm.

Stress can significantly impact digestion, leading to issues such as constipation and diarrhea. Managing stress is vital for regular digestion. Techniques such as yoga, meditation, and deep breathing exercises can help reduce stress levels and facilitate better digestion. Set aside a few minutes each day to relax and focus on your breath, or join a yoga class to incorporate gentle movements and mindfulness into your routine.

Physical activity is another natural way to improve digestion. Regular exercise helps stimulate the activity of the intestines and promotes blood flow to the digestive tract. Aim for at least 30 minutes of moderate exercise most days of the week. Activities like walking, running, swimming, and cycling are excellent options. Additionally, simple stretches can also be beneficial for those who have a sedentary lifestyle.

Be mindful of your eating habits. Eating too quickly can lead to poor digestion and discomfort. Take the time to chew your food thoroughly and savor each bite. Eating in a relaxed environment can also promote better digestion. Avoiding distractions like screens while eating allows your body to focus on the digestive process, leading to a better experience overall.

Another key consideration is to identify and avoid food intolerances or sensitivities. Foods like dairy, gluten, or certain sugars can lead to digestive problems in some individuals. Keep a food diary to track what you eat and any symptoms you experience. Over time, you may notice patterns that can help you identify foods that may be triggering irregular digestion.

Lastly, it’s essential to listen to your body. If you encounter persistent digestive issues, it may be wise to consult a healthcare professional. They can provide personalized guidance and may recommend deeper investigations if necessary.
